WebAug 13, 2024 · In service, the test tap is grounded via the tap cover. In bushings rated > 69 kV (i.e. > 350 kV BIL), one of the outermost layers is connected to a potential tap while the outermost layer is grounded internally. The potential tap ‘floats’ in service with the tap cover in place. The capacitance of the multiple layers between the core and ...

WebA C1 power factor/dissipation factor test checks the health of the bushing’s main core insulation, while the C2 measurement is used to assess the bushing tap compartment’s insulation plus the outermost main core insulating wraps and surrounding filler material. Often, C2 serves as early detection for moisture ingress or other contaminants ... WebTest Tap:-The test tap is provided for the measurement of Capacitance, Tan delta and Insulation Resistance ( IR ) value of the bushing. It is connected with a copper lead to the last condenser foil of the core directly. During normal service this test tap is electrically connected to the mounting flange trough test tap cover.
